ESRB ratings are used to categorize video games based on their content and age-appropriateness, helping consumers make informed decisions about which games are suitable for themselves or their children.
Key Features
- Age ratings for different age groups
- Content descriptors for specific types of content such as violence, language, and sexual themes
- Interactive elements like online interactions and in-game purchases
